Cognitive Bias in Intelligence Analysis: Testing the Analysis of Competing Hypotheses Method - Intelligence, Surveillance and Secret Warfare
Whitesmith, Martha (Senior Intelligence Analyst, Ministry of Defence)
This book critiques the reliance of Western intelligence agencies on the use of a method for intelligence analysis developed by the CIA in the 1990s, the Analysis of Competing Hypotheses (ACH).
